Why Responding to Rental Inquiries Matters
A prompt response to rental inquiries not only showcases your professionalism but also helps to build trust with potential tenants. It sets the tone for a positive relationship and demonstrates your commitment to providing excellent customer service. By responding promptly, you can also avoid missed opportunities and potential conflicts that may arise from delayed communication.
Best Practices for Responding to Rental Inquiries
1. Ensure Promptness
Respond to rental inquiries as soon as possible, ideally within 24 hours. This ensures that you're addressing potential tenants' concerns and questions in a timely manner, which is essential for maintaining a positive reputation.
2. Be Professional and Polite
When responding to rental inquiries, maintain a professional tone and be polite. Avoid using jargon or technical terms that may confuse potential tenants. Use language that's clear, concise, and easy to understand.
3. Provide Accurate Information

5. Follow Up
After responding to a rental inquiry, be sure to follow up with the potential tenant to ensure their questions have been addressed. This demonstrates your commitment to providing excellent customer service and can help build trust with the tenant.
